Demographics details for Livonia, MI vs Cordele, GA

Population Overview

Compare main population characteristics in Livonia, MI vs Cordele, GA.

Data Livonia Cordele
Population 93,779 9,914
Median Age 45.2 years 36.7 years
Median Income $92,458 $33,166
Married Families 46.0% 24.0%
Poverty Level 5% 20%
Unemployment Rate 2.8 4.5

Population Comparison: Livonia vs Cordele

  • In Livonia, the population is higher at 93,779, compared to 9,914 in Cordele.
  • Residents in Livonia have a higher median age of 45.2 years compared to 36.7 years in Cordele.
  • Livonia has a higher median income of $92,458 compared to $33,166 in Cordele.
  • A higher percentage of married families is found in Livonia at 46.0% compared to 24.0% in Cordele.
  • The poverty level is higher in Cordele at 20%, compared to 5% in Livonia.
  • Cordele has a higher unemployment rate at 4.5% compared to 2.8% in Livonia.

Health Statistics Comparison: Livonia vs Cordele

  • In Cordele, a higher percentage report poor mental health at 20.4% compared to 15.1% in Livonia.
  • Depression is more prevalent in Livonia at 23.1% compared to 21.7% in Cordele.
  • Cordele has a higher smoking rate at 24.6% compared to 15.4% in Livonia.
  • Binge drinking is more common in Livonia at 20.3% compared to 11.7% in Cordele.
  • Cordele has higher obesity rates at 46.6% compared to 28.8% in Livonia.
  • There is a higher percentage of disabled individuals in Cordele at 20.0% compared to 13.0% in Livonia.
